titleOfInvention NUCLEIC ACID CONTAINING OR CODING THE STRUCTURE-HINGE STRUCTURE OF HISTONS AND THE FIELD SEQUENCE (A) OR THE POLYADENYLATION SIGNAL TO INCREASE EXPRESSED CODER IS BODY
abstract 1. A nucleic acid sequence containing or encoding: a) a coding region encoding at least one peptide or protein; b) at least one histone stem-loop structure, c) a poly (A) sequence or polyadenylation signal; where said peptide or protein contains a therapeutic protein or a fragment, variant or derivative thereof selected from: (i) therapeutic proteins used to treat metabolic or endocrine disorders; (ii) therapeutic proteins used to treat blood disorders, abnormalities of the cardiovascular system, respiratory system diseases, cancer or tumor diseases, infectious diseases or immunodeficiencies; (iii) therapeutic proteins used for hormone replacement therapy; (iv) therapeutic proteins used to reprogram somatic cells into pluri- or omnipotent stem cells; (v) therapeutic proteins selected from adjuvant or immunostimulatory proteins; and (vi) antibodies. 2. The nucleic acid sequence of claim 1, wherein the at least one histone stem loop loop is heterologous with respect to a coding region encoding at least one peptide or protein, where the coding region should preferably not encode a histone protein or fragment thereof , a derivative or variant performing the function of a histone or histone-like function. 3.
